New Insights into DNA Damage Reveal Overlooked Vulnerability

Recent research uncovers a previously unrecognized weak point in DNA, highlighting the effects of environmental factors and oxidative stress on genetic material.

Editorial Staff1 min read

A new study has shed light on a previously overlooked aspect of DNA damage, revealing how environmental factors like light can compromise genetic material.

The research indicates that oxidative stress, often resulting from inflammation, also plays a significant role in damaging DNA.

This discovery emphasizes the complexity of DNA vulnerabilities and the need for further investigation into how these factors interact.
